Pelosi: “This morning, I spoke to the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ff Mark Milley to discuss available precautions for preventing an unstable president from initiating military hostilities or accessing the launch codes and ordering a nuclear strike.” https://t.co/TbPYE5YAwk — PolitiTweet.org

After yesterday’s mob attack on the Capitol, the Secret Service says it’s ready for Inauguration Day less than two weeks from now and has been preparing for the National Special Security Event for more than a year. Calls the inauguration “a foundational element of our democracy.” https://t.co/hAC81GcEDI — PolitiTweet.org

@jmartNYT @tylerpager With picks this week for attorney general, commerce secretary and labor secretary, Biden has now selected nominees for all cabinet-level positions. Biden has already touted it as the most-diverse cabinet ever but it won't satisfy everyone. No Latinas or AAPIs to be secretaries. — PolitiTweet.org
